Job responsibilities include: Providing process engineering support to the Enterprise Capital Engineering team across the tissue value stream . The Process Engineer for this role will provide capital project leadership and support in the development, layout, design, installation, and start-up of equipment and ancillary systems to address capacity, capability, innovation, safety, and obsolescence needs for the NA Tissue Value Stream. Collaborate across the Supply Chain, R&E, Procurement, tissue mill sites, key OEM equipment suppliers, technical service providers, and construction contractor networks. Interacts frequently within various segments of the Tissue Value Stream organization as well as Mill Operating Teams, Staff Manufacturing, Research & Development (R& D ), Planning, Distribution, and Procurement. Receives project assignments from the Capital and Senior Capital Managers. May flow to work as needed across the NA Tissue Value Stream. Lead single or multiple product or process improvement projects with a financial scope of up to $10 0 million from conception through commercialization, with primary focus on Beech Island OLU project execution. Provide functional leadership and creativity in the initiation of design, development, and optimization of manufacturing and converting equipment and processes to meet unit objectives . Develop knowledge and skills in leadership of the application of engineering principles, scientific analysis, and project management. Carry out all job responsibilities in a safe manner. Develop equipment and processes that meet safety codes, policies and guidelines. Provide for the safety and well-being of operators, maintenance, and other personnel. Identify complex technical issues and provide necessary solutions to determine root cause. Identify complex technical issues and provide necessary solutions to eliminate root cause . Conceive, develop, validate , and share ideas leading to new or improved products, processes, materials, systems or scientific knowledge aligned with business unit objectives . Coach and mentor team members to increase technical understanding and ability to execute programs to improve NA tissue value stream business results. Drive a culture of protected and documented innovation to protect and defend Kimberly-Clark proprietary technology, products, and business processes through appropriate use of patents and trade secrets. This includes completing required project documentation through EFS, EDR, and Appropriation activities and following PMP documentation including Corporate Financial Instructions (CFIs). To succeed in this role, you will need the following qualifications: Required Qualifications Bachelor’s or master’s degree in engineering or relevant scientific degree . 3+ years of related technical experience in mill, production or staff R& D environments. Manufacturing facilities, Vendor, OEM visits as projects dictate ( i.e. equipment review, acceptance testing, etc.) . Travel is required for this role. Typical level of travel is 2 5 -30 %, heavier travel may be required at times during project installations depending on duration or complexity of project. Preferred Qualifications Experience in improving the safe operation of high-speed manufacturing and/or converting equipment and processes, with an ability to translate that knowledge into support of process, product, and capacity improvements. Strong analytical skills and ability to mine process data from process data systems and provide clear direction as to opportunity areas for improvemen t. Familiarity with machine startups. Experience working with external technical service providers. Demonstrated ability to lead, mentor and coach less-experienced engineers. Evidence of continuing self-development . Led by Purpose.
